Database: Refactor MP1 database for multi seat usage (1 Viewer)

Anthony Vaughan

MP Donator
  • Premium Supporter
  • June 25, 2015
    566
    292
    Home Country
    United Kingdom United Kingdom
    Looking in the MP log file there are various lines claiming that the Music, Picture, and Video databases have been created, but later on in the log the error that we had before occurs.
    Thanks for trying that. They didn't do anything for me either but I saw them recommended in a blog. You should revert back to the previous config files.

    I am a loss as to how to resolve this. Three of my machines were set-up from scratch with only MP installed with Windows 10 Pro and I have never had any issues with the installation of the refactored version using exactly the same BAT file you are using. The same goes for my 32 bit Windows 7 machine. As I say, I have used EF with SQLite all over the place and thought I had a reliable configuration.

    I'll let you know if I come across an answer/solution.
     

    ajs

    Development Group
  • Team MediaPortal
  • February 29, 2008
    15,646
    10,595
    Kyiv
    Home Country
    Ukraine Ukraine
    I can start watching my movie in the kitchen and if I log in in the bed room with my user I can resume it there.
    I do the same in MP1, or even so, I start watching a movie in Kodi in the kitchen, stop, go to the bedroom and MP1 prompts me to start watching from the same place where I stopped.
    MP2 offers user management
    I'm glad there's no such thing in MP1. I think it's a useless thing in a home theater.
    (MP2 knows which plugins installed and all elements for non existent plugins are invisible)
    It's the same here. MP1 knows everything about installed or not installed plugins.
     
    Last edited:

    ajs

    Development Group
  • Team MediaPortal
  • February 29, 2008
    15,646
    10,595
    Kyiv
    Home Country
    Ukraine Ukraine
    What do you mean about no automatic database update anymore?
    I install new DB Refactor version, start MP Configurator, and get empty DBs and one error in log:
    Code:
    [2022-02-22 12:56:41,167] [Config ] [GetDataLoadClearDownThread 1] [ERROR] - GetKeywordPictureList: error: An error occurred while executing the command definition. See the inner exception for details. - inner: code = Error (1), message = System.Data.SQLite.SQLiteException (0x800007BF): SQL logic error
    no such table: keywordpicture
       в System.Data.SQLite.SQLite3.Prepare(SQLiteConnection cnn, String strSql, SQLiteStatement previous, UInt32 timeoutMS, String& strRemain)
       в System.Data.SQLite.SQLiteCommand.BuildNextCommand()
       в System.Data.SQLite.SQLiteCommand.GetStatement(Int32 index)
       в System.Data.SQLite.SQLiteDataReader.NextResult()
       в System.Data.SQLite.SQLiteDataReader..ctor(SQLiteCommand cmd, CommandBehavior behave)
       в System.Data.SQLite.SQLiteCommand.ExecuteReader(CommandBehavior behavior)
       в System.Data.SQLite.SQLiteCommand.ExecuteDbDataReader(CommandBehavior behavior)
       в System.Data.Common.DbCommand.ExecuteReader(CommandBehavior behavior)
       в System.Data.Entity.Infrastructure.Interception.DbCommandDispatcher.<>c.<Reader>b__6_0(DbCommand t, DbCommandInterceptionContext`1 c)
       в System.Data.Entity.Infrastructure.Interception.InternalDispatcher`1.Dispatch[TTarget,TInterceptionContext,TResult](TTarget target, Func`3 operation, TInterceptionContext interceptionContext, Action`3 executing, Action`3 executed)
       в System.Data.Entity.Infrastructure.Interception.DbCommandDispatcher.Reader(DbCommand command, DbCommandInterceptionContext interceptionContext)
       в System.Data.Entity.Internal.InterceptableDbCommand.ExecuteDbDataReader(CommandBehavior behavior)
       в System.Data.Common.DbCommand.ExecuteReader(CommandBehavior behavior)
       в System.Data.Entity.Core.EntityClient.Internal.EntityCommandDefinition.ExecuteStoreCommands(EntityCommand entityCommand, CommandBehavior behavior)
    [2022-02-22 12:56:42,511] [Config ] [GetDataLoadClearDownThread 1] [ERROR] - GetPictureDataList: error: The 'HDR' property on 'picturedata' could not be set to a 'null' value. You must set this property to a non-null value of type 'System.Boolean'.  - inner:
     

    ajs

    Development Group
  • Team MediaPortal
  • February 29, 2008
    15,646
    10,595
    Kyiv
    Home Country
    Ukraine Ukraine
    I start MP1, go to My Video (empty DB) and MP1 crash ...
     

    Attachments

    • MediaPortal-Error.log
      59.6 KB

    Users who are viewing this thread

    Top Bottom